mb/google/brya/var/redrix: Configure camera EEPROM power always on
Remove EEPROM power source interconnect with camera power on/off and keep it always on. There appears to be a rare case where the camera EEPROM is not able to be read from. As a workaround, this patch leaves the EEPROM power rail on in S0. BUG=b:229049914 TEST=tested the changes with redrix 5MP(ov5675/hi556) camera.
